diff options
author | Andrei Emeltchenko <andrei.emeltchenko@intel.com> | 2014-11-06 10:31:59 +0200 |
---|---|---|
committer | Szymon Janc <szymon.janc@tieto.com> | 2014-11-06 12:31:31 +0100 |
commit | 2ce0bb3c23e65e8a2dd910b517a94dc0c7da00c5 (patch) | |
tree | 81d3d83aac624c01a6b15da6c7000e4281745504 /android/handsfree.c | |
parent | b6e754e1bf187f52407a9fbd12e420a9df26b2a4 (diff) | |
download | bluez-2ce0bb3c23e65e8a2dd910b517a94dc0c7da00c5.tar.gz |
android/handsfree: Add support for new API for volume_cmd_cb
Volume Command notification callback has new parameter bdaddr.
Diffstat (limited to 'android/handsfree.c')
-rw-r--r-- | android/handsfree.c |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/android/handsfree.c b/android/handsfree.c index babcdf276..c5aa99abc 100644 --- a/android/handsfree.c +++ b/android/handsfree.c @@ -361,6 +361,7 @@ static void at_cmd_vgm(struct hfp_context *context, ev.type = HAL_HANDSFREE_VOLUME_TYPE_MIC; ev.volume = val; + bdaddr2android(&dev->bdaddr, ev.bdaddr); ipc_send_notif(hal_ipc, HAL_SERVICE_ID_HANDSFREE, HAL_EV_HANDSFREE_VOLUME, sizeof(ev), &ev); @@ -396,6 +397,7 @@ static void at_cmd_vgs(struct hfp_context *context, ev.type = HAL_HANDSFREE_VOLUME_TYPE_SPEAKER; ev.volume = val; + bdaddr2android(&dev->bdaddr, ev.bdaddr); ipc_send_notif(hal_ipc, HAL_SERVICE_ID_HANDSFREE, HAL_EV_HANDSFREE_VOLUME, sizeof(ev), &ev); |